I would like to write a MATLAB function called ''myTranspose()'' which gets a matrix and returns the transpose of this matrix using loops, BUT without using transpose operator ('). can someone help me?

Answers (1)

KSSV
KSSV on 25 Jan 2021
A = rand(3) ;
[m,n] = size(A) ;
B = A ;
for i = 1:m
for j = 1:n
B(i,j) = A(j,i) ;
end
end
